Key Players and Their Statistical Impact
Examining the Knicks vs. Heat player stats of pivotal players reveals the dynamics of each game. For the Knicks, players like Patrick Ewing and Carmelo Anthony have left indelible marks. Ewing's dominance in the 90s, particularly his scoring prowess and rebounding, anchored the team and fueled their rivalry with the Heat. Anthony, known for his offensive versatility and clutch performances, showcased his scoring ability and provided a scoring threat that shifted the game’s momentum. On the Heat side, the contributions of stars such as Alonzo Mourning and Dwyane Wade have been nothing short of legendary. Mourning's defensive presence, including his shot-blocking and rebounding, provided the backbone of the Heat’s defense, while Wade’s scoring, assists, and clutch plays made him a perennial All-Star. Statistical Indicators of Victory
Knicks vs. Heat player stats provide crucial indicators that predict game outcomes. Key statistical categories such as points scored, rebounds, assists, and steals often correlate directly with wins and losses. When a team excels in these areas, their chances of victory increase. For example, a team that dominates the boards through rebounds is more likely to control the pace of the game and create second-chance scoring opportunities. High assist numbers indicate effective ball movement and teamwork, contributing to higher scoring efficiency. Similarly, a team with a high number of steals often disrupts the opponent's offense, creating turnovers and fast-break opportunities. Detailed analysis of the Knicks vs. Heat player stats helps to identify the statistical benchmarks associated with winning. This includes looking at player efficiency ratings (PER), which measure a player’s per-minute productivity, and true shooting percentage (TS%), which accounts for field goals, three-pointers, and free throws. These metrics often reveal the players who consistently perform at a high level and contribute significantly to team success. In addition to individual stats, team-based stats, such as offensive and defensive ratings, also play an important role. High offensive ratings indicate a team’s ability to score efficiently, while high defensive ratings reflect their ability to prevent opponents from scoring.
